Imagine having a tune in your mind that you wish to transform into a captivating music arrangement using your personal computer. A skilled arranger might finish this process in just a couple of hours. Utilizing Akoff Music Composer, a software dedicated to songwriting, you can easily craft your music. By humming your melody into a microphone, the Composer captures your vocalization, transcribes it into a MIDI format, generates accompanying chords, and arranges the entire piece for you. Remarkably, you don’t need a MIDI keyboard or any prior musical knowledge to produce your creation. Simply select your desired tempo, activate the metronome, and hum your melody into the mic. The Composer records your audio as a digital file and meticulously analyzes the sound waves to identify the musical notes, subsequently forming a standard MIDI sequence. It then smartly aligns the chord progression to complement your original melody. Afterward, you can choose a particular music style, and the Composer will complete a fully arranged song for you, ensuring that the harmonic structure of your melody is well-integrated into the final composition. This innovative approach allows anyone to bring their musical ideas to life effortlessly.

AudioLM is an innovative audio language model designed to create high-quality, coherent speech and piano music by solely learning from raw audio data, eliminating the need for text transcripts or symbolic forms. It organizes audio in a hierarchical manner through two distinct types of discrete tokens: semantic tokens, which are derived from a self-supervised model to capture both phonetic and melodic structures along with broader context, and acoustic tokens, which come from a neural codec to maintain speaker characteristics and intricate waveform details. This model employs a series of three Transformer stages, initiating with the prediction of semantic tokens to establish the overarching structure, followed by the generation of coarse tokens, and culminating in the production of fine acoustic tokens for detailed audio synthesis. Consequently, AudioLM can take just a few seconds of input audio to generate seamless continuations that effectively preserve voice identity and prosody in speech, as well as melody, harmony, and rhythm in music. Remarkably, evaluations by humans indicate that the synthetic continuations produced are almost indistinguishable from actual recordings, demonstrating the technology's impressive authenticity and reliability. This advancement in audio generation underscores the potential for future applications in entertainment and communication, where realistic sound reproduction is paramount.
